A » 3D printing enhances modular construction by enabling precise and rapid production of complex architectural components, reducing waste and labor costs. It allows for custom designs tailored to specific project needs, improving structural efficiency and aesthetic appeal. Additionally, 3D printing can streamline the assembly process, ensuring consistent quality and facilitating quicker project completion. This innovative approach significantly boosts the sustainability and adaptability of modern architectural practices.
